Nintendo Switch was released worldwide on March 3, 2017, and the device is one of the best hybrid gaming consoles. A China-based gaming Vastking has now launched a gaming console G800 with Windows 10 operating system and it resembles the look-and-feel of the Nintendo Switch. As it runs Windows 10, you can also enjoy all the features of the operating system.

The G800 is a portable gaming tablet with the full version of Windows 10, meaning that you can play almost any games compatible with the OS and enhance the experience with the controllers implemented on the sides of the console.

The device features detachable wireless controllers and it is connected to the side of the tablet. Just like any controllers, it has a plus (+) or minus (-) button, trigger button and two thumbsticks.

The Vastking G800 features a standard 8-inch IPS display with a resolution of 1920×1200. It is powered by Intel Pentium N4200 processor with clock speed of just 1.1GHz. It has 32GB of internal storage and expandable via SD card. The company plans to launch the device in 2GB, 3GB, 4GB and 6GB of RAM.

Vastking has installed 3,400 mAH battery in the device which is of course not enough considering it is a portable gaming tablet with Windows 10. The connectivity options include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, USB-A, USB-C and headphone jack. Vastking hasn’t announced the release date of the G800 yet but it is expected to arrive next year.
